Output 7bb75c1a519e0c385efc513f21961b49cac789e1536a4f463a43adbd3786498e:9

value
2193984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a94757d36b0f7f1b804ec6b9668765474dd92c46 OP_EQUAL
address
3H85ay1VufQmuFHCW8LuhfDKB1Bq5K6cMH
transaction
7bb75c1a519e0c385efc513f21961b49cac789e1536a4f463a43adbd3786498e
confirmations
291545
spent
true